In the arsenal of ways of carbon consumption and emissions reduction, the main tasks of modern metallurgy, briquetting occupies significant places. Today, briquetting is a cost-effective, industrially mastered technology capable to process natural and anthropogenic materials without their preliminary high-temperature treatment. The book summarizes the scientific research and the practice of briquettes use for the smelting of cast iron, steel, ferroalloys and the production of direct reduced iron. Comparison with sintering and pelletization is given. Particular attention is paid to debunking the myths about briquetting, which are firmly rooted in the minds of metallurgists.

This book explains how the specifics of Stiff Extrusion influence on the metallurgical properties of Extruded Briquettes. The practical experience of the utilization of Stiff Extrusion in metallurgy obtained so far suggests that this technology can substitute (partially or by 100%) environmentally unfriendly sintering. The authors start reviewing the existing briquetting technologies, providing the reader later on with the specifics of stiff extrusion briquetting technology. Other aspects treated are the applications of extruded briquettes on blast furnace and for the production of manganese ferro alloys. The authors suggest stuff extrusion briquetting technology for direct reduction iron production and list several alternative unconventional applications.

The compaction and pressing of fine-grained materials is becoming of considerable industrial significance. Rational management of raw materials requires the compaction and briquetting of several tens of millions of tons of fine-grained materials per year. Hence the scale and importance of the problem justify a very serious approach to the question, both as a research project and in its practical application. This book reviews the fundamentals of the technology for compacting and briquetting fine-grained materials, as achieved by means of various types of machines and numerous techniques. Areas covered include the design, construction and operation of the machines and equipment used. Processes are described both in stamp and roll presses and under static as well as pulsatory pressure, for selected finely disintegrated materials. Mathematical models provide the necessary dynamic analyses, as well as computer simulation and syntheses. The book presents the fundamentals for the design of devices for feeding/compacting the charge for briquetting presses as well as examples of practical application of the various methods and equipment.

Rather than simply describing the processes and reactions involved in metal extraction, this book concentrates on fundamental principles to give readers an understanding of the possibilities for future developments in this field. It includes a review of the basics of thermodynamics, kinetics and engineering principles that have special importance for extractive metallurgy, to ensure that readers have the background necessary for maximum achievement. The various metallurgical unit processes (such as roasting, reduction, smelting and electrolysis) are illustrated by existing techniques for the extraction of the most common metals. Each chapter includes a bibliography of recommended reading, to aid in further study. The appendices include tables and graphs of thermodynamic qualities for most substances of metallurgical importance; these are ideal for calculating heat (enthalpy) balances and chemical equilibrium constants. SI Units are used consistently throughout the text.
